2. Sunlight Love
Always give your plant sunlight daily for at least 6 hours to
keep it healthy. When choosing where to put your plant ensure that it’s in an
area with sunlight. Depending on the plant you choose, some plants may need
more sunlight than others. Basil, marigolds and lettuce are all easy to grow and
thrive in sunlight!
3. Water With Caution
While it is important to water your plants regularly, you should avoid overwatering it. Overwatering can lead to root rot, yellowing leaves, insects etc. To avoid these issues, water your plants once in the early morning. This allows the water to absorb into the soil before the sun gets too hot. Depending on the plant the amount of watering needed will vary.
4. Learn About Your Soil
Healthy soil makes a healthy garden! Before planting, it’s good to learn about your soil. Simple ways to learn are by reading books like Soil Science for Gardeners, reading the packaging of your soil or doing online research. Adding compost to your soil can improve your plants health, along with using a Soil Meter to monitor the pH and nutrient levels of your soil.
